Hamster Nutrition and the Role of Multivitamins
A hamster's diet predominantly consists of grains, vegetables, and fruits, complemented by commercial hamster pellets. While these foods provide a balanced diet, there can sometimes be nutritional gaps due to varying quality and availability of produce and hamster feed. Multivitamins serve as a nutritional supplement to ensure your pet receives all requisite vitamins and minerals.

Key Vitamins and Minerals for Hamsters
Just like humans, hamsters require a variety of vitamins and minerals to maintain their health. Vitamins A, B, C, D, E, and K are important for addressing a range of health needs from vision and skin health to proper bone development and immune function. Additionally, minerals like calcium and phosphorous are essential for bone health, while iron and magnesium support energy levels and proper organ function.

Dosage and Administration
When it comes to administering multivitamins to hamsters, it is crucial to adhere to recommended dosages to avoid overdosing, which can lead to toxic buildup in their small systems. Consult with your veterinarian to determine the proper dosage based on your hamster's weight, age, and health status. Some multivitamins come in liquid form, which can be added to water, while others might be in powder form, sprinkled over food, or even in palatable chewable form that hamsters perceive as treats.
